Kane Brown is melting hearts with his latest Instagram post, showcasing the most adorable photo of him cuddling with his three children. 

In the photo, Brown is seen smiling as he is surrounded by Kingsley Rose, Kodi Jane, and Krewe Allen. 

“My babies 🙏🏽,” Brown captioned the post, which was flooded with sweet comments from friends, fellow artists, and fans. 

One fan declared, “Take note….This is what a great father looks like. ❤️” 

Another shared, Thought I really liked you before kids but the dad life makes me adore you even more 😍 so sweeeet!”

The singer, known for his chart-topping hits and genuine family values, often gives fans glimpses into his personal life, celebrating moments like these with his wife Katelyn and their young family. 

The couple recently shared a video capturing the sweet moment that their daughters, Kingsley and Kodi, first met baby Krewe while in the hospital. It’s clear that the siblings instantly fell in love with the newborn baby as they shared laughs, smiles, and a few tears together during this memorable moment. 

Brown is currently juggling fatherhood with a busy career schedule. According to recent social media posts, he’s been in the studio working on his highly anticipated new album in between tour dates. 

Next up, the superstar will perform at the York State Fair on July 19, followed by his return to Boston’s Fenway Park on July 20. While in the Northeast, the superstar will also stop by New York City for a performance on Good Morning America’s Summer Concert Series on July 19. 

During the recent leg of Brown’s In The Air Tour, Katelyn popped up at several shows to join him in singing their chart-topping duet, “Thank God,” for fans. With a slew of dates booked through the end of the year, including a run in Australia, many fans are wondering if Katelyn will be on hand to sing at his upcoming shows.

During a recent Q&A on Instagram, Katelyn revealed that her main focus is taking care of baby Krewe at the moment, however, she may be able to join her husband on short trips. 

“Now with a newborn, my focus is getting him on a schedule and sleeping so I have to really dedicate my time to getting him in his routine, so I won’t be traveling too much, only if they are easy bus trips and short travel,” she wrote.  

Krewe is just 3 weeks old. He was born on Tuesday, June 18, and introduced to the world via social media in a joint post shared by Kane and Katelyn. The post included a sweet snapshot of Kane and Katelyn with their baby boy as well as photos of each of them holding baby Krewe and a precious photo of his little feet.

Since bringing Krewe home, Katelyn has periodically updated fans on social media, offering glimpses into their life with a newborn. She’s shared moments from pumping sessions and posted photos and videos of the girls bonding with their new little brother. She also shared a heartwarming video of the Kingsley and Kodi welcoming Krewe home with signs, chalk, and balloons.
